  • Gopal,

    May i know the reason for looking C6713 alternate development kit ? You may not expect all the C6713 DSK features in other development kit. The C6748 LCDK is a low cost development kit which has EMIF 16 bit interface in J14 connector and few GPIO's. You would also get better support for this device.

  • Gopal,

    Why do you have the requirement for 32-bits EMIF?

    The C6748 has two EMIF buses that can operate simultaneously giving you much better total throughput than with the C6713. The 16-bit EMIFB is for a DDR2 memory and can run up to 156MHz == 312MT/s, which is equivalent in a general sense to running a 32-bit EMIF at 156MHz yet the C6713 only operates up to 100MHz for its SDRAM interface.

    For asynchronous peripheral accesses, the EMIFA interface also runs up to 100MHz like the C6713, although only 16 bits wide. But you can be accessing DDR2 over EMIFB at the same time as accessing peripherals over EMIFA.

    The C6748 LCDK would be a much more suitable development platform for your other requirements. And you can move to the latest CCSv7 without any licensing fees.
